Allenton Rd Grass Autocross - all welcome 28/02/10
« on: February 26, 2010, 12:34:21 pm »

28 Feb 9.30am ish
Autocross
476 Allanton Road, Taieri
Pretty much all you needs is a WOF-able car, overalls and a helmet.  You don’t even need to be a member, so friends and family etc can enter as well.
More info at www.oscc.co.nz
OSCC 2010 AC Championship round

 
 
 
If anyone needs helmet/overalls, im more than happy to share mine.
